Welcome to Saint Joseph Hospital, a 433-bed hospital founded in 1877 by the Sisters of Charity of Nazareth as the first Hospital in Lexington, Kentucky. Led by Sister Euphrasia Stafford, the mission to provide compassionate care to the poor and underserved is still carried out today. Saint Joseph Hospital holds over two dozen national ranks and recognitions and is recognized as a 2024 Best Place to Work in Kentucky.

Responsibilities
Job Summary / Purpose
Assist Interventional Cardiologists, Radiologists, and Vascular Surgeons in Cardiac Cath Lab / Interventional Radiology / Endovascular with cardiovascular diagnostic and interventional procedures. Performs duties as scrub and monitoring staff. Provides radiation safety and general safety for patients, themselves and other staff. Provides patient and family education and supports customer satisfaction and service excellence. Works as part of the Cath Lab / IR / Endovascular team and supports nursing functions. Demonstrates and maintains all applicable competencies related to imaging and device based equipment used in these Interventional procedures areas. Performs with competency in Code STEMI and Code Stroke alerts. Documents and evaluates the outcome of interventions. Provides on call services as assigned

Qualifications
Minimum Qualifications
Required Education and Experience
Graduate of an Accredited School of Radiologic Technology
Required Licensure and Certifications
Licensed Medical Radiographer : MRAD : KY
Registered Technologist Radiography ARRT (RTR, RCES, RCIS)
AHA Basic Life Support – CPR (BLS-CPR) – within 5 days
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) - within 6 months
